解决Oracle服务的停止命令(oracle停止服务命令)
Oracle数据库服务器是企业中极其重要的资源,因此在关闭服务器时需要格外小心。它有一些特定的命令可以停止服务器。
在Oracle数据库开发或维护过程中,有时需要关闭服务器来处理一些问题。这时就要使用Oracle服务的停止命令来关闭数据库服务器,以免影响系统正常运行。Oracle服务的停止命令可以分为逻辑关闭和物理关闭两类。
第一种命令是SHUTDOWN,它是Oracle数据库服务的逻辑关闭命令,用于停止服务器的逻辑处理功能,但是不会涉及对数据文件的更改。该命令的使用格式如下:
SHUTDOW IMMEDIATE
这个命令会立即停止Oracle服务,要求所有连接处于断开状态,而未完成的事务会回滚,不过可以通过SHUTDOWN TRANSACTIONAL来实现不回滚事务的停止命令。
另一种命令是SHUTDOWN ABORT,它是一种物理关闭命令,会对文件产生立即更改,而且与SHUTDOWN IMMEDIATE不同,这个命令在某种程度上使文件可能损坏,因此建议在使用之前先备份文件。这也是一个强制性的关闭命令,用于在复杂的崩溃时协助数据库正常启动。使用格式如下:
SHUTDOWN ABORT
此外,Oracle还有一个停止命令,即ALTER SYSTEM DISABLE RESTRICTED SESSION,它可以把Oracle服务房的数据库变成受限状态,这样用户就无法再提交任何事务以及对数据库的任何更改。使用的格式如下:
ALTER SYSTEM DISABLE RESTRICTED SESSION;
综上,Oracle服务有三种停止命令,分别是SHUTDOWN IMMEDIATE、SHUTDOWN ABORT 以及ALTER SYSTEM DISABLE RESTRICTED SESSION,根据实际情况选择,可以帮助管理员做好Oracle数据库服务的关闭工作。